ZnO nanoparticles (NP) are extensively used in numerous nanotechnology applications; however, they also happen to be one of the most toxic nanomaterials. This raises significant environmental and health concerns and calls for the need to develop new synthetic approaches to produce safer ZnO NP, while preserving their attractive optical, electronic, and structural properties. In this work, we demonstrate that the cytotoxicity of ZnO NP can be tailored by modifying their surface-bound chemical groups, while maintaining the core ZnO structure and related properties. This study was designed to evaluate the biodegradation and feasibility of growing three oyster mushroom species - Pleurotus ostreatus, Pleurotus citrinopileatus, and Pleurotus djamor - on three different cigarette filter waste substrates: intact cigarette filters, blended cigarette filters, and smoked, intact cigarette filters. Cigarette filters are a common waste and are made primarily of cellulose acetate. Oyster mushrooms (Pleurotus spp.) have been shown to degrade synthetic polymers similar to cellulose acetate. The Bagmati and its tributaries have been an integral part of the Kathmandu Valley civilization. The river not only became a source of sustenance for the Valley's population but also gained religious-cultural significance. However, rapid urbanization and increasing industrial activities have transformed this once pristine river into an open sewer. Governmental organizations, NGOs, and community members are working towards improving the conditions of the Bagmati River through restoration projects and public awareness campaigns. Since what we call civilization began some 12,000 years ago, the mean temperature of Earth has not varied more than 1°C from the average. The forecast change in temperature of from 1.5 to 4°C (2.7 to 7°F) by 2100 has no equal in the recent history of the planet. Changes in the energy output of the sun, changes in the relative position of the sun and Earth, shifting locations of the continents, mountain building, volcanic eruptions, and changes in atmospheric composition all combine to cause our climate to change. Hydropower dates back to the use of waterwheels to grind grain in Greece over two thousand years ago. Modern hydropower is a mature industry that has been used to generate electricity since the 1880s by capturing flowing water with a dam or other diversion structure and channeling it through a waterwheel or turbine. According to a 2012 report by the International Energy Agency, internationally dams are responsible for the largest amount of power generation from a renewable source; yet they have come under scrutiny as a result of environmental and social impacts perceived to be unsustainable (McCully 2001).
